Ultimate Technical SEO Checklist for 2024

Technical SEO forms the foundation of your website’s search performance. Without a solid technical base, even the best content can struggle to rank. Use this comprehensive checklist to ensure your site is technically optimized.

1. Crawlability & Indexation

Robots.txt

  • ☐ File exists at /robots.txt
  • ☐ Not blocking important pages
  • ☐ Pointing to XML sitemap
  • ☐ Allowing Googlebot access

XML Sitemap

  • ☐ Sitemap exists and is accessible
  • ☐ Submitted to Google Search Console
  • ☐ Includes all important URLs
  • ☐ Excludes non-indexable pages
  • ☐ Under 50,000 URLs per sitemap
  • ☐ Updated when content changes

Indexation

  • ☐ Check index status in Search Console
  • ☐ Proper use of noindex tags
  • ☐ No duplicate content issues
  • ☐ Canonical tags implemented correctly

2. Site Speed & Core Web Vitals

Largest Contentful Paint (LCP)

Target: Under 2.5 seconds

  • ☐ Optimize and compress images
  • ☐ Use modern image formats (WebP, AVIF)
  • ☐ Implement lazy loading
  • ☐ Preload critical resources
  • ☐ Use a CDN

First Input Delay (FID) / Interaction to Next Paint (INP)

Target: Under 100ms

  • ☐ Minimize JavaScript execution
  • ☐ Break up long tasks
  • ☐ Remove unused JavaScript
  • ☐ Defer non-critical scripts

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S)

Target: Under 0.1

  • ☐ Set explicit image dimensions
  • ☐ Reserve space for ads
  • ☐ Avoid inserting content above existing content
  • ☐ Use font-display: swap for web fonts

3. Mobile Optimization

  • ☐ Responsive design implementation
  • ☐ Mobile-friendly test passed
  • ☐ Viewport meta tag configured
  • ☐ Touch targets sized appropriately (48px minimum)
  • ☐ No horizontal scrolling required
  • ☐ Text readable without zooming
  • ☐ No intrusive interstitials

4. Site Architecture

  • ☐ Clear URL structure
  • ☐ Logical site hierarchy
  • ☐ Important pages within 3 clicks from homepage
  • ☐ Breadcrumb navigation implemented
  • ☐ Internal linking strategy
  • ☐ No orphan pages

5. URL Structure

  • ☐ URLs are clean and descriptive
  • ☐ Using hyphens (not underscores)
  • ☐ Lowercase letters only
  • ☐ No special characters or spaces
  • ☐ Include target keywords where relevant
  • ☐ Keep URLs reasonably short

6. HTTPS & Security

  • ☐ SSL certificate installed
  • ☐ All pages served via HTTPS
  • ☐ HTTP redirects to HTTPS
  • ☐ No mixed content warnings
  • ☐ Certificate not expired
  • ☐ HSTS header implemented

7. Structured Data

  • ☐ Organization/LocalBusiness schema
  • ☐ Article/BlogPosting schema for content
  • ☐ Product schema for e-commerce
  • ☐ FAQ schema where appropriate
  • ☐ Breadcrumb schema
  • ☐ Validated with Schema Markup Validator

8. International SEO (If Applicable)

  • ☐ Hreflang tags implemented correctly
  • ☐ Language targeting in Search Console
  • ☐ URL structure for international content
  • ☐ No duplicate content across regions

9. Technical Health Checks

  • ☐ No 404 errors on important pages
  • ☐ 301 redirects for moved content
  • ☐ No redirect chains or loops
  • ☐ Server response time under 200ms
  • ☐ GZIP or Brotli compression enabled
  • ☐ Browser caching configured

Tools for Technical SEO Audits

  • Google Search Console: Monitor indexation and errors
  • Google PageSpeed Insights: Core Web Vitals analysis
  • Screaming Frog: Comprehensive site crawling
  • GTmetrix: Performance testing
  • Ahrefs/SEMrush: Technical SEO audits
  • Schema Markup Validator: Structured data testing
